Jak wybrać najlepsze środowisko programistyczne Java®?
Zintegrowane środowisko programistyczne Java® (IDE) to program, który zawiera różne narzędzia do tworzenia kodu programowania, zarządzania modułami programu oraz debugowania i testowania kodu Java®. Każda IDE ma inne funkcje, jest kompatybilny z określonymi systemami operacyjnymi i zapewnia graficzny interfejs do użytku w tworzeniu programów. Wybierając najlepsze środowisko programistyczne Java®, należy rozważyć układ IDE, łatwość użycia, funkcje, cenę i kompatybilność systemu. Dostępnych jest wiele IDE, więc prawdopodobnie będziesz musiał zważyć wszystkie te czynniki, aby znaleźć ten, który najlepiej pasuje do twoich potrzeb, budżetu i systemu komputerowego.
Jednym z największych czynników w wyborze najlepszego środowiska programistycznego Java® jest układ interfejsu programu. Będziesz chciał znaleźć IDE, która ma łatwe do naśladowania menu i grupuje ikony paska narzędzi w logiczny sposób. Jeśli utworzysz programy wymagające interfejsu graficznego, będziesz chciał znaleźć IDE, która zawiera narzędzia do projektowania pukłady rogramu. Organizacja kart IDE jest również ważna, ponieważ słabo zorganizowana IDE może utrudnić śledzenie modułów programu Java®. Programy z czystym układem zwykle dają opcję ukrycia zakładek i menu, których nie potrzebujesz, co może sprawić, że interfejs wyglądałby na znacznie czystszy i łatwiejszy do naśladowania.
Ważne jest, aby upewnić się, że wybrana IDE obsługuje potrzebne funkcje. Jeśli chcesz używać wtyczek do dostępu do baz danych lub sieci za pośrednictwem programu, najlepsze środowisko programistyczne Java® ułatwi dodawanie i używanie wtyczek. Kolejną pomocną funkcją w IDE jest automatyczne ukończenie, co sugeruje słowa, gdy zaczniesz pisać kod. Większość IDE obsługuje tę funkcję, ale niektórzy używają tej funkcji mniej wydajnie niż inne. Inne pomocne funkcje, na które należy szukać, obejmują możliwość wypróbowania programów w IDE i IDZdolność E do znalezienia błędów w twoim kodzie.
Chociaż istnieje kilka w pełni polecanych, dostępnych bezpłatnych IDE, niektóre wykorzystywane do programowania oprogramowania korporacyjnego mogą kosztować wysokie koszty i mogą wymagać wielu opłat licencyjnych. Może się również okazać, że musisz zapłacić za wszelkie aktualizacje produktu, które pojawią się, więc będziesz chciał wziąć pod uwagę te koszty, szczególnie jeśli korzystasz z programu w przedsiębiorstwie. Kompatybilność systemu jest również ważnym czynnikiem w wyborze najlepszego środowiska programistycznego Java®, ale wiele IDE w 2011 r. Obsługuje wiele platform i sprawia, że kompatybilność jest mniejsza.